The Ultimate Guide to Healthy Frying: Forget the Air Fryer, Try These Tricks Instead!

If you don't own an air fryer but still want to enjoy oil-free fried food, there are a few simple methods you can try.

0
63

It is a common misconception that air fryers are the only solution to reduce oil absorption in fried foods. However, there are alternative methods to achieve the same result. Let’s explore some of these techniques to make our fried foods healthier.

1Use Oil-Absorbing Paper

Place a few sheets of dry paper towels on a plate and put the fried food on top. Let it sit for a few minutes, and the paper towels will absorb the excess oil.

2Water Frying

A unique method to cook sausages and hot dogs is by frying them in water. This technique ensures they are cooked without the excess grease while maintaining their tenderness and flavor.

3Non-Stick Pans

Non-stick pans are excellent for frying eggs without the need for oil. The eggs will cook perfectly without burning and sticking to the pan.

4Butter Frying

Some foods, such as beef, eggs, rice, bacon, and sausages, can be fried in butter instead of oil. This method adds flavor and reduces oil absorption into the food.

Excess oil in our food is unhealthy, so these techniques help reduce oil absorption, contributing to a healthier lifestyle.
